Abstract

A process for the production of a compound of Formula I, or a pharmaceutically acceptable salt thereof, or a pharmaceutically acceptable prodrug ester thereof, comprising cleaving a lactam of formula II wherein the symbols are as defined, with a base; and precursors therefor and processes for the preparation of the precursors. The compounds of Formula I are pharmaceutically active compounds which are selective inhibitors of Cyclooxygenase II.
